Ceci est une page optimisée pour les mobiles. Cliquez sur ce texte pour afficher la vraie page.

XL 2010 Valeurs uniques d'une base de données

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

Caroline ;-))

XLDnaute Junior
Bonjour,

J’ai une base de données et je souhaiterais connaître les valeurs uniques, et cela, pour chaque variable (colonne).

Ex. : ma base de départ (onglet « bdd »)


Je souhaiterai avoir : (onglet « DDD ») pour dictionnaire de données


Il faudrait prévoir une base avec des nombres des colonnes et de lignes plus grands que ceux de mon exemple.

Voici ce que j’ai fait (manuellement) :
- Copier onglet « bdd » et créer un onglet « DDD » (coller valeurs)
- Séparer chaque colonne de données par une colonne vide
- Pour chaque colonne de données, supprimer les doublons (mes données ont des en-têtes)
- Trier le résultat
- Puis, il y a le décorum…
o Mettre des bordures
o Largeur des colonnes vides : 0,5



Est-ce que vous pouvez m’aider ?

Merci d’avance !
 

Pièces jointes

Bonjour Pierre-Jean, Benoit59, Laetitia, Dranreb, le forum

@Pierre-Jean
Code(s) redoutable une nouvelle fois -)

Comme l'instruction :
Dico(x) = Dico(x) + 1 (pour incrémenter les items)

+ la modification de la fonction tri.

Toujours très agréable de lire ces codes pour une demande intéressante.
Bravo Pierre-Jean. ++
 
Un grand Merci à PierreJean et à TheBenoit59 !

Vos macros sont impeccables et très utiles, surtout quand il s’agira d’analyser les grosses bases de données…Combien de temps épargné ! 🙂

Dranreb, si tu as du temps pour de plus amples informations … car pour l’instant, je nage / coule.
Et encore, pas certaine que je comprenne...

Bravo aux génies du VBA !
 
Bonjour PierreJean et Thebenoit59,

J’ai voulu utiliser vos macros sur une base plus grosse (3 fois plus de lignes et 7 colonnes supplémentaires par rapport à la précédente).
Les 2 macros trouvent le même résultat.

Pour le nombre d’occurrences, c’est bon. Il reste un petit problème pour l’ordre d’affichage des occurrences.
Ainsi, je trouve dans l’onglet « DDD », 2 variables qui ne sont pas ordonnées.


Est-ce qu’il y a moyen de modifier ça ?
Merci ! Bon WE !
 

Pièces jointes

Bonsoir Pierre-Jean, Caroline, DranReb,..(et le forum)

Ne pourrait-on pas prendre svp le problème dans la BDD de départ en modifiant la colonne avec une fonction qui traiterait à la fois la lettre après le "L" et ce qui parait être le mois de référence ?

Dans ce cas, les codes de Pierre-Jean devraient fonctionner sans problème non ?

Un essai
 

Pièces jointes

-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D

Discussions similaires

Les cookies sont requis pour utiliser ce site. Vous devez les accepter pour continuer à utiliser le site. En savoir plus…